Book Overview

Set nine years after a tragic loss, Saint follows Elias, a young man who has rebuilt his life around the ancient superstitions of the sea. Once a boy who scoffed at old tales, he now carries a deep reverence for the ocean’s whims, earning him the reputation of the luckiest sailor in the Narrows. On the cusp of achieving his father’s dream—owning a ship, a crew, and a trader’s license—Elias’s path collides with a mysterious dredger from the Unnamed Sea. Her secrets threaten everything he holds dear, forcing him to question his faith, his choices, and the very currents that guide his life.

About the Author

Adrienne Young is a New York Times bestselling author known for her vivid fantasy worlds and emotionally charged characters. Her works, including the Fable series and the Sky in the Deep duology, have captivated readers globally. Young’s background in storytelling and her love for folklore shine through in every page, making her a favourite among young adult audiences. She resides in the Pacific Northwest, where the rugged coastline inspires her tales of adventure and resilience.
